About this experience

See the Falls without paying the entrance fee and view the waterfalls from the historic bridge. Our licensed Safari guide can assure your safety when passing thru the wildlife area on the way to the Victoria Falls bridge and the mighty falls behind. Save yourself the entrance fee per person and join us on the bridge tour where you get a nice view of the Falls as well..but note,its not a guided tour of the Falls itself. Unique here is that we are a small group and we will make sure that you will be able to cross the border post between Zimbabwe and Zambia without needing a Visa. When getting to the bridge, i will take you to a small Museum and give you a brief explanation on the history of the area and the culture of Zimbabwe. Then i will take you to a look out where you have a magnificent view of Victoria Falls bridge and the falls beyond,and if we are lucky,..have more wildlife sightings as well on our walk back to town.

From our office in town, set off on a guided bush walk where you may encounter impalas, warthogs, and baboons. Pass a local arts and craft market before reaching the border, where your Savannah Adventures guide handles all formalities smoothly. Continue for about 10 minutes as the sound and mist of Victoria Falls build, leading you to the iconic Victoria Falls Bridge. Walk across at a relaxed pace with time for unforgettable views of the Falls, Batoka Gorge, and the Zambezi River—without paying park entrance fees. Cross into Zambia (no visa required), visit a small museum, and continue to a panoramic viewpoint. Return with your guide or stay at the Bridge Café.
